Even though chances are slim that the devs see this or even consider it, I'd like to share some ideas I had during my FCs map sessions. I'll split it in two sections - gameplay and rewards, because both can be improved to make mapy more fun!
Gameplay
Right now the main gameplay aspect of maps, or rather: The Canals is to kill trash mobs. Isnt that fun?!
...no, it isnt.
The Hidden Canals had a good idea by adding something else - The madrakes and Abrahamus cardgame. By a stretch you can also count the miniboss in the 4th room and the mainboss in the last room of each map aswell as Abrahamu und the Namazu. Bottomline: Anything that breaks away from killing one pack of trash after the next one is good!
So, here are a few ideas of mine how to achieve that:
- add O3's animal farm: Once the chest is being touched, some curious smoke turns everyone into a frog/pig/imp and three circles appear. If every circle has a matching player in it, the cages stay closed and you dont have to fight the trash. If you dont make it, you have to fight. You have a 10 second time limit to match the circles.
- add one friendly mob that you dont have to kill - the reverse Namazu, if you want. It doesnt has to drop from the ceciling but could rather hide among the normal mobs
- add an optional "killchain" - most often mobs come at least in pairs, but I'm thinking mainly about those groups of 4 elementals - manage to kill all 3 wind, then all 3 fire, then 3 earth, then 3 water without breaking the chain will award you an extra chest or a guranteed rainbow-door
- adapt the "collect things and turn them in"-FATE-mechanic - add an NPC/monster that wants you to collect the gems on the ground. Either as replacment for the trash mob fight (then with a time limit) or rather while fighting the trash. The reward would be an extra treasure or a rainbow-door.
- make the treasure a "heal-mimic": The chest turns into a monster upon touching but you get a time-limit to heal it to full HP. If you do, you dont have to fight the trash - if you dont, the chest calls for help (aka the cages open up)
